            So it only has one power transformer to supply the Voltages to all the boards.
            Since you are getting the blinking RED light that means the power supply is running but we do not know if the Voltages are fluctuating so it makes the light blink or there is problem in the power supply or in the main board.
            We will need to test the Voltages at the connector on the power supply that goes to the main board.
            http://www.shopjimmy.com/catalogsear...rson+LF391EM4F
            I would start checking the DCV on those jumper wires (close to the black connector) which have the labels for them to tell you what the Voltages should be and also the control signal names.
            Also check ALL the diodes in the secondary side of the circuit.

                    So the test points are:
                    J141: BL-ADJ
                    J153: PROTECT3
                    J156: BL-SW
                    J81: LED -CONT
                    J79: AMP+13V
                    J80: P-ON+21V
                    J85: P-ON H2
                    J86 :3.3V
                    So none of the Voltages on the jumpers are going ON and OFF? If that is the case then more likely you have main board problem not the unstable power supply problem.

                              Re: Emerson LF391EM4F blinking red nothing else

                              The PS-ON is fine (2.0V), the 13V is fine.
                              But the main board is not sending B-SW (BL-ON), BL-ADJ, which makes sense because you have blinking LED lights right now.
                              The PROTECT3 = 0.4V I am not sure if that is normal or not.
                              I do suspect that you have main board problem.
